As an admissions authority, the Governors of Archbishop Blanch School are required by the 1998 School Standards and Framework Act to consult with all other Admission Authorities, the Local Authority and Diocese of Liverpool, before finalising admissions arrangements and policy for September 2021 (as set out in Section 1.42 of the School Admission Code).
In the light of this requirement we are pleased to enclose the Governors’ proposed 2025 admissions arrangements and policy and would welcome any comments. it is proposed a change to the following:
- Removal of the Music Aptitude Criteria, with 8 places added across all remaining criteria. (3 Christian, 2 Muslim, 1 Other World Faith and 2 Local)
- The period specified for attendance at worship for 2025 admissions is 2020,2022 ,2023 & 2024. During the period specified for attendance at worship churches have been closed or limited capacity for public worship has been in effect, so it is not possible to calculate fairly or accurately the points available for attendance at worship. Therefore, where points are allocated for 2020, they will be given up to 20th March 2020, with no points available for any applicant for 2021.
